I've been testing the HD-E1 with Peter Finzel Test Disc, which is a german PAL test DVD.

2:2 with film flags: deinterlaces correctly, full resolution.
2:2 with video flags: the static background is full resolution, while the moving parts are half resolution. This results in jagged edges around moving objects.

This player only does flag reading deinterlacing. The majority of UK DVD's are not correctly flagged as film, which means when there is motion you are only getting half the vertical resolution. This is a shame because even the cheapest upscalers are capable of detecting a 2:2 cadence.

DVD players that do pass this test: Sony PS3 (although only at 576p), Sony DVP-NS76H, all the players based around the Zoran Vaddis 888 including Samsung and Toshiba upscalers.
